In the book Careless People: Murder, Mayhem, and the Invention ofThe Great Gatsby, author Sarah Churchwell theorizes inspiration for the murder in the book from the 1922 double murder of Edward Hall and Eleanor Mills, which happened contemporaneously to when he was starting work on the novel. In real life, Fitzgerald met his future wife, Zelda, when he was commissioned as a second lieutenant in the infantry and assigned to Camp Sheridan outside ofMontgomery, Alabama, where she was a beautiful debutante.
